About 3,5-dichloro-4-ethoxybenzaldehyde

3,5-dichloro-4-ethoxybenzaldehyde (PubChem CID 880269) has the molecular formula C9H8Cl2O2 and a molecular weight of 219.07 g/mol. Its IUPAC name is 3,5-dichloro-4-ethoxybenzaldehyde.

What are the key properties of 3,5-dichloro-4-ethoxybenzaldehyde?
3,5-dichloro-4-ethoxybenzaldehyde has a molecular weight of 219.07 g/mol, XLogP of 3.20, 3 rotatable bonds, 0 hydrogen bond donors, and 2 hydrogen bond acceptors.
